Temple is good enough to beat CPA playing bad if they play good. The first game Skogens got in foul trouble and they are average without him. He is a very good player. It was fairly close at half, but CPA pressured the 3rd quarter, created a lot of havoc and steals, and built up a pretty big lead. Temple scored some baskets late which made the score closer - a 13 point win. The CPA loss was Temple's first loss to a 1A opponent at home in about 3 years.

I believe CPA will win Saturday. They are playing muh better now than they were when they beat Temple the 1st time.
